Output e21362278b52605462c1aedae9508a966bfcb21088286af709d4497884e90160:0

value
151415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4c855605e36548e1cdfd69f70b106ca312158f OP_EQUAL
address
3MbGu8A9Z3wvo65SuKvo5RjEdoXMzwLYFQ
transaction
e21362278b52605462c1aedae9508a966bfcb21088286af709d4497884e90160
spent
true